| | RE: Sleep Answer 11/29/12 5:51 AM as a reply to Robin Woods. Robin: in my experience, 1st path is like the A&P of paths. You are thus more likely to be euphoric, energetic, wired, etc, which causes you to sleep less. You can also be more aggressive, arrogant, ardent, zealous, loving, desirous, optimistic, opinionated, etc. You may think life is awesome and that you, in particular, are also awesome. You may have powerful full-body energetic phenomena, including kundalini going up the spine, tremors, orgasmic sensations, full body terror (you'll notice the exciting aspect of it more than usual), "powers," both in a mystical sense (e.g. visions), and in a more common sense (e.g. you are likely exceptionally charismatic during this phase), etc, etc.
It is an excellent occasion to deeply understand, first hand, the disadvantages of euphoric feelings. Both in how they influence your life, your perspectives on life, and as a consequence the life of those around you. Pleasure can distort perception as much as much as pain does during the dark night, but in a more optimistic, grandiose and self-serving manner (the belief you have gotten it right, the belief that you have good intentions, etc). No need to take my word for it. Make good use of this opportunity.
If you can, either complement or replace your vipassana practice with more grounding kinds of practice, such as Chi Kung. Use the extra energy to open the energetic pathways IN THE LEGS (that's golden advice right there). |
